CloudStack is recommended for enterprises and service providers that need a customizable and scalable cloud solution. It is particularly suitable for those who require support for multiple hypervisors and need to integrate with existing infrastructure components. It is also ideal for organizations preferring open-source solutions with active community support.

Gluestack, like any other customizable UI library, is built to make styling less cumbersome. It comprises a set of themed and unstyled components easily integrated across different platforms and devices. Originally, Gluestack was a part... - Source: dev.to / over 2 years ago
Just like the other libraries mentioned in this article, Gluestack is another unstyled component library. Originally a part of NativeBase, the developer team created this library to prevent bloat and enhance maintainability of the project. - Source: dev.to / almost 3 years ago
